Bounder & Beaky visit Tokyo, Japan

Location visited

Tokyo, Japan

Date of visit

Jan 23rd – Feb 2nd 2011

Purpose of visit

To speak at SCBWI Japan and visit several International Schools meeting hundreds of children.

Comments

Bounder & Beaky LOVE Tokyo. They were guest speakers at the Society of Children's Writers and Illustrators get together and were humbled meeting so many outstanding talented author/illustrators such as Naomi Kojima and the lovely illustrator Yoko Yoshizawa.

Yoko took them to meet Hachiko, the famous loyal Akita dog. They were thrilled to meet Japanese furry friends.

They also visited the awesome giant Buddha in Kamakura and then hiked up a steep mountain path through a plum orchard to the shrine of the fox. Visitors leave offerings of fried tofu. The local squirrels and raccoons have a midnight feast.

Bounder and Beaky were tempted to hang here all night and join in the funny feast.

While visiting the international schools they met children from over forty nations, they elected to have lunch with the kids in the cafeteria. The children thought they were the cutest things since sliced bread.
